
Just yesterday, we reported that US Olympic gymnast Simone Biles had also revealed that she was abused by Dr Larry Nassar. Today, another Olympic gymnast, McKayla Maroney is also speaking out.
McKayla Maroney who had previously received a settlement of $1.25 million from USAG had signed a non-disclosure agreement as part of the deal, has decided she still wants to speak up about her molestation. The only problem is that the non-disclosure agreement also entails a $100,000 fine, should she ever speak publicly about the molestation.
She is to join other 88 women who are currently scheduled to deliver victim impact statements at Nassar’s sentencing, which has begun and is set to run through Friday. This is despite the fact that Dr Nassar is already facing a 60-year sentencing for child pornography.
While the sum for the NDA is hefty, media personality, Christy Teigen, and actress Kristen Bell alongside producer Michael Schur took to Twitter to say they will help pay the sum so long as she speaks up.
